private void btnInsert_Click(object sender, EventArgs e) { var selected = listBox1.SelectedItem; if (selected is null) { MessageBox.Show("Please Select Tag", "Validation Error", MessageBoxButtons.OK, MessageBoxIcon.Error); } else { ActionResult saveResult = formCtrl._saveFormData(new RoomsWithTagsModal() { Room = (string)selected, Tag = comboBox1.SelectedItem.ToString(), }); if (saveResult.State) { RoomsWithTagsModal saveObj = saveResult.Data; MessageBox.Show("Rooms With Tag : " + saveObj.Room + "-" + saveObj.Tag + " Sucessfully Saved!", "Save Message", MessageBoxButtons.OK, MessageBoxIcon.Information); initForm(); } else { MessageBox.Show(saveResult.Data, "Save Message", MessageBoxButtons.OK, MessageBoxIcon.Error); } } }
private void btnDelete_Click(object sender, EventArgs e) { var selected = listBox2.SelectedItem; if (selected is null) { MessageBox.Show("Please Select Room", "Validation Error", MessageBoxButtons.OK, MessageBoxIcon.Error); } else { int id = 0; ActionResult roomsWithTagsResult = formCtrl._getFormData(typeof(RoomsWithTagsModal), "RoomsWithTags"); if (roomsWithTagsResult.State) { foreach (RoomsWithTagsModal room in roomsWithTagsResult.Data) { if (room.Room == (string)selected && room.Tag == comboBox1.SelectedItem.ToString()) { id = room.RoomsWithTagsID; } } } ActionResult deleteResult = formCtrl._deleteFormData(new RoomsWithTagsModal() { RoomsWithTagsID = id }); if (deleteResult.State) { RoomsWithTagsModal deleteObj = deleteResult.Data; MessageBox.Show("Room " + (string)selected + " Sucessfully Deleted!", "Delete Message", MessageBoxButtons.OK, MessageBoxIcon.Information); initForm(); } else { MessageBox.Show(deleteResult.Data, "Delete Message", MessageBoxButtons.OK, MessageBoxIcon.Error); } } }